What is a Plummer Bearing?

What is Plummer Bearing and Its Importance in Industry?

Plummer Bearings play a crucial role in many industrial applications. These bearings support a rotating shaft and are typically mounted in a housing. One key feature of Plummer bearings is their ability to accommodate misalignment. This helps minimize wear on machinery, extending its lifespan. They are commonly used in heavy machinery and mining equipment.

When choosing a Plummer bearing, consider several factors. The load capacity is essential. Ensure the bearing can support the weights involved in your application. Additionally, look at the materials used for durability. Corrosion resistance is often vital in harsh environments.

Tips: Regularly check the lubrication of your Plummer bearing. Inadequate lubrication can lead to increased friction and eventual failure. Pay attention to any unusual noise or vibration. These could be signs that maintenance is needed. Even a small oversight in care can result in costly repairs or downtime.

Key Components and Design Features of Plummer Bearings

Plummer bearings are essential components in various industrial applications. They support rotating shafts and provide alignment and load distribution. Key components of a Plummer bearing include the bearing block, the shaft, and the housing. The design features often include a simple structure, which allows for easy installation and maintenance.

The housing is typically made of cast iron or steel, ensuring durability. The layout enables quick access to the bearing for inspection and lubrication. Misalignment can lead to premature failure, highlighting the need for precision in its installation. Adjustments must be made during initial setup to prevent operational issues. Maintenance Practices for Longevity of Plummer Bearings

Plummer bearings play a crucial role in supporting rotating shafts in various industrial applications. To ensure their longevity, regular maintenance is vital. A few effective practices can significantly extend the lifespan of these components.

Regular lubrication is essential. Using the correct type and amount of lubricant prevents friction and overheating. Too little lubrication may lead to wear and tear. Conversely, too much can attract dirt and debris, causing issues. It’s important to monitor and maintain the proper levels.

Additionally, regular inspections can help identify potential problems early. Look for signs of wear, such as discoloration or unusual noises. Any signs of misalignment should be addressed immediately. A misaligned plummer bearing can lead to premature failure. Keeping the surrounding area clean reduces contamination risks.
